What is Wallet Data Synchronization?

Wallet data synchronization refers to the process of harmonizing financial data across various platforms, devices, and applications. This synchronization ensures that users have access to their latest transaction history, balance, and account information regardless of where or how they check their wallets. With increased reliance on digital wallets, effective synchronization is crucial for various transactions, from online shopping to instore purchases.

Importance of Wallet Data Synchronization

The efficiency and accuracy of wallet data synchronization can lead to improved financial management. Here are some reasons why it matters:

  • Consistency: Keeping transaction history uptodate across different devices ensures that users have access to accurate financial data at all times.
  • Accessibility: Syncing wallet data allows users to access their financial information from multiple devices, making financial management more flexible and convenient.
  • Security: Proper synchronization often includes security features that protect sensitive information during transfer, enhancing user confidence in digital transactions.
  • Timeliness: Automated synchronization ensures that any changes made on one platform are immediately reflected on others, which is crucial for making timely financial decisions.
  • Tips for Enhancing Wallet Data Synchronization

    Here are five effective strategies to improve wallet data synchronization. Each strategy is complemented with practical examples to illustrate its application in realworld scenarios.

  • Utilize CloudBased Services
  • Explanation: Cloud storage allows for seamless synchronization across different devices and platforms. By storing wallet data in the cloud, users can access their financial information anywhere, anytime.

    Example: Services like Google Drive or Dropbox can be used to store walletrelated data in a secure folder. Set up automatic backups to ensure that your transaction history is always saved in the cloud. This way, even if you lose your device, you can retrieve critical financial information from any internetenabled device.

  • Enable Automatic Updates
  • Explanation: Enabling automatic updates ensures that the wallet applications always run the latest version, typically including enhanced synchronization features and security updates.

    Example: On your smartphone, enable automatic updates for your wallet applications through the app store settings. This approach guarantees that you benefit from improvements and bug fixes without manual intervention, keeping synchronization smooth and efficient.

  • Integrate Multiple Platforms
  • Explanation: Many wallet services offer integration options with various financial platforms (like bank accounts, PayPal, etc.). This integration helps consolidate data for improved accuracy.

    Example: If you use a digital wallet alongside a budgeting app, linking both applications can create a unified financial overview. This synchronous approach allows you to track spending and income in one place, enhancing decisionmaking based on realtime data.

  • Regular Backup of Data
  • Explanation: Regularly backing up wallet data is vital to safeguard against loss or corruption. This practice allows users to recover their data in the event of an unexpected problem.

    Example: Schedule periodic backups of your wallet application data to an external hard drive or cloud storage. For instance, if you use a cryptocurrency wallet, routinely export your transaction data and save it securely to avoid losing access to critical funds.

  • Ensure Strong Security Protocols
  • Explanation: Implementing robust security protocols protects wallet data during synchronization, minimizing the risk of data breaches and unauthorized access.

    Example: Use twofactor authentication (2FA) for your wallet application. When linking wallet data across devices, ensure that you receive verification codes via SMS or authenticator apps, securing your account against potential hacks and unauthorized synchronization.

    Common Questions About Wallet Data Synchronization

  • What are the benefits of wallet data synchronization?
  • Wallet data synchronization provides numerous benefits, including consistent access to financial information, improved decisionmaking, enhanced productivity, and increased security. By keeping wallet data synchronized, users can manage their finances more efficiently.

  • How does synchronization work between multiple devices?
  • Synchronization works through cloud services or directly between applications, where updates made on one device are sent to the server and propagated to other devices. Most wallet applications leverage APIs to facilitate this process, ensuring that the latest data is always available across all platforms.

  • Can I sync my wallet data if I change devices?
  • Yes, syncing wallet data across different devices is often achievable if you log into the same account on each device. Many wallet applications automatically sync data upon logging in, so all your updated information should be available seamlessly.

  • Is there a risk associated with wallet data synchronization?
  • While synchronization is convenient, risks include potential data breaches or loss during the transfer process. Employing strong security measures, such as encryption and twofactor authentication, can mitigate these risks significantly.

  • What should I do if my wallet data doesn't sync correctly?
  • If wallet data fails to sync properly, several troubleshooting steps can be taken, including checking for internet connectivity issues, ensuring that automatic updates are enabled, and logging out and back into the app to trigger a manual synchronization attempt.

  • How does synchronization differ between various wallet applications?
  • Different wallet applications may utilize distinct methods for synchronization, such as cloudbased solutions or manual updates. It's essential to review each application's specific features to understand how synchronization operates and what may be required for optimal performance.
